Tom Corbett, Space Cadet was one of the hottest science fiction properties of the 1950's. Tom was presented to the public as a comic strip in the daily funny papers, as a television series in 1951 and then again in 1954, as a radio series in 1952 and as a series of books. Standby for Mars was the first volume in the book series, introducing Tom and buddies Astro and Roger Manning and the world of the Solar Guard to readers. The book opens as Tom, Astro and Roger enter Space Academy and begin their training to become members of the Solar Guard. The boys go through the rigors of Academy training and are taken under wing by Capt. Steve Strong and Dr. Joan Dale. Relations between the boys are stained with Tom and Astro unable to understand Roger's hostile attitude towards the Academy and the Guard. The trio seem destined to be bounced out of the Academy due to the rancor between Roger and the other two boys. Then the boys are stranded on Mars when their training flight crash lands and in the ensuing action Roger reveals the cause of his animosity towards the Solar Guard and the Academy.
